Major Blaze in Quezon City: Community Response and Safety Measures

A large fire broke out in Quezon City, Philippines, raising significant alarm and prompting immediate action from local emergency services. The incident occurred in a highly populated region, leading to concerns about the safety of residents and surrounding properties. As firefighters worked tirelessly to extinguish the flames, community members came together to support those affected by this disaster. This article explores the details of the fire, response efforts by authorities, and ongoing initiatives aimed at assessing damage while ensuring community safety.

Fire breaks out in Quezon City - Xinhua

Fire Disruption in Quezon City: Residents Advised to Remain Cautious

The blaze that erupted in a crowded area of Quezon City has caused considerable disruption for local inhabitants. Emergency responders quickly arrived on-site to combat the rapidly spreading flames. Eyewitnesses described scenes of chaos as families evacuated their homes while firefighters worked around the clock to manage the situation. Authorities are advising residents to remain alert for any potential flare-ups as residual hazards may persist following the incident.

The local government is extending assistance to those impacted by providing temporary housing and essential supplies. In light of this event, residents are encouraged to follow these safety guidelines:

  • Stay Updated: Keep track of news reports and updates from emergency management agencies.
  • Avoid Restricted Zones: Steer clear of areas designated as fire zones so that emergency personnel can operate without hindrance.
  • Report Emergencies: Notify authorities if you observe any unusual smoke or signs of fire activity.
